Abstract:
The invention relates to a cationically curable composition with at least one cationically polymerizable component, a first photoinitiator releasing an acid when irradiated with actinic radiation of a first wavelength λ1, and a second photoinitiator releasing an acid when irradiated with actinic radiation of a second wavelength λ2, wherein the second wavelength λ2 is shorter than the first wavelength λ1, and wherein the second photoinitiator, after irradiation of the composition with actinic radiation of the first wavelength λ1, shows an absorption of actinic radiation of the second wavelength λ2 in the composition that is sufficient to activate the second photoinitiator and fix the composition. Furthermore, a method is described for the joining, casting, molding, sealing and/or coating of substrates using the cationically curable composition.
